Flight Fare Conditions

Refunds Refundable up to 7 days before departure subject to $50 fee per one-way fare
When a solo traveller has paid the 2 fare minimum and others subsequently book on the same flight leg, one fare is refundable subject to $50 fee per one-way fare. Contact us to request
Changes Up to 24 hours before departure booking can be rescheduled or open-dated, credit valid for 12 months, subject to $50 fee per one-way fare
Less than 24 hours before departure no changes permitted, and the fare will be forfeited if passenger is a no-show
For all changes, if the new fare is greater than the original fare paid, an additional charge equal to the fare difference will be incurred
No charge to transfer to another passenger, subject to availability
Special Fares 'Special' class fares may be offered on the repositioning legs of Standard fare flights booked by other passengers (other than between Wellington and Takaka). If passengers travelling on Standard fares cancel or reschedule their booking, the repositioning flight may be cancelled, in which case holders of Special fares may credit their fares towards another booking or receive a full refund. For any other cancellation or change, our standard conditions apply
Children and Infants Child fares: Available to children under 12 years old on Wellington-Takaka service only
Infant fares: Children under 2 years of age are free of charge if seated on an adult’s lap but infants are not allocated a separate baggage allowance. Baggage may be included in accompanying adult allowances
Body weight declaration Personal body weights must declared accurately for the safe loading of our aircraft. We may weigh passengers on check-in to verify. If there is a discrepancy between your declared weight and your actual weight, we reserve the right to refuse carriage of yourself or baggage with no refund

Restricted items

Passengers are not permitted to carry hazardous substances. In particular:

  • Camping gas, flammable fluids. Gas canisters are available in Takaka and Karamea for $8. Passengers may carry one double action ignition lighter or small packet of safety matches on their person
  • Aerosols greater than 0.5 litres may not be carried
  • Lithium batteries with lithium battery content less than 2g, up to 160Wh can only be carried if installed in a small portable device such as a laptop or camera. All devices with lithium batteries must be stored in the aircraft cabin. Lithuium batteries greater than 160Wh (such as e-bike batteries) cannot be carried
  • Firearms and ammunition can be carried by prior arrangement. Ammunition <5kg, separated from firearm, bolt from firearm removed. A valid firearms licence must be available for inspection
  • Diving cylinders, paint, pesticides may not be carried

Unaccompanied Children

Unaccompanied children aged between 7 and 11 years can travel at the child fare on our Wellington-Takaka service but must be booked by contacting us. Full contact details must be provided for the adult checking the child in and for the person picking the child up at the destination. If the flight is cancelled for any reason we may reschedule the booking to another flight. Additional fees and conditions may apply if Golden Bay Air is required to use alternate transport operators
